Key Information: ICD-10 Coding for Lytic Lesion

Essential facts and insights about ICD-10 Coding for Lytic Lesion

Use ICD-10 code C79.51 for secondary malignant neoplasm of bone, ensuring proper documentation in clinical notes.

Primary ICD-10-CM Codes

Secondary malignant neoplasm of bone

Billable Code
C79.51
Billable

Diagnostic Criteria

  • • Confirmed metastasis to bone via imaging or biopsy.

Applicable To

  • • Metastatic bone cancer

Important Notes

  • • Ensure primary malignancy is coded first.

Multiple myeloma not having achieved remission

Billable Code
C90.00
Billable

Diagnostic Criteria

  • • Serum M-protein >3 g/dL
  • • ≥3 lytic lesions on skeletal survey

Applicable To

  • • Multiple myeloma with lytic lesions

Important Notes

  • • Ensure to document the remission status.
Ancillary Codes

Additional codes that may be used with this diagnosis

M85.89

Other specified disorders of bone, multiple sites

Use for benign lytic lesions when no neoplasm is identified.

M84.58XA

Pathological fracture, other site, initial encounter

Use if a pathological fracture is present.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is the ICD-10 code for a lytic lesion?

The ICD-10 code for a lytic lesion depends on the underlying cause. C79.51 is used for metastatic bone cancer, while C90.00 is for multiple myeloma with lytic lesions.

How do you document a lytic lesion?

Document the lesion's size, location, margins, and classification using the Lodwick system. Include biopsy and imaging results for accurate coding.
